Tapestry's template parser should identify <img src="..."/> and convert the src
attribute to use a context Asset

Currently, if you have:
<img src='/images/icon.png"/>
you do not get the benefit of version numbering, far future expires headers,
gzip compression, etc. To get that benefit you must:
<img src="${context:images/icon.png}"/>
It seems to me that Tapestry could recognize this pattern, and perhaps <input
type="image"/> as well, and automatically supply the context binding, if the
attribute content is simple text.
